Ugonna Onyekwe

Ugonna Nnamdi Onyekwe (born July 14, 1979) is a British-Nigerian former professional basketball player. He played professionally from September 2003 through April 2011 before retiring from the sport to enter the business world. Onyekwe played college basketball at the University of Pennsylvania where he became just the second Ivy League player ever to be named the Ivy League Player of the Year two times (2002, 2003).
==Early life==
Onyekwe was born in Lagos, Nigeria. He spent his youth there until moving to London, England, where he spent the majority of his teenage years.〔 Before his junior year of high school, Onyekwe moved to Mercersburg, Pennsylvania, United States.〔 He starred on Mercersburg Academy's basketball team for his final two years of prep school. At the start of the 1999–2000 school year he enrolled at the University of Pennsylvania, located in Philadelphia;〔 specifically, Onyekwe enrolled in their Wharton School of Business.
